[0033] The technical scheme of the present invention is described in further detail below:
[0034] The invention discloses an adaptive exterior marker lamp based on vibration induction, which comprises a lamp body, a vibration sensor, a light intensity sensor, a brightness adjustment module, a miniature vibration generator, a rechargeable power supply and a control module, and the control modules are respectively It is electrically connected to a vibration sensor, a light intensity sensor, a brightness adjustment module, and a rechargeable power supply, the lamp body is electrically connected to the brightness adjustment module, and the rechargeable power supply is electrically connected to the miniature vibration generator;
[0035] The miniature vibration generator is used to generate electricity when the car is started, and store the electric energy in the rechargeable power supply;
[0036] The brightness adjustment module is used to adjust the brightness of the lamp body...
